This was a cute little Christmas romance. Sutton, the main character, hates Christmas. She winds up in a crazy situation and stays with widower Gus, taking care of his two children who are on Christmas break in exchange for a place to stay. But, Gus is the king of Christmas and even owns a Christmas store in town. But, things aren't always what they appear to be on surface.

I enjoyed this story and the characters. The ending wasn't what I expected it would be for a Christmas romance.

A fun and light read for the holidays with some funny parts and a cosy setting. But it somehow felt both long and too quick at the same time? The romance itself happened pretty quickly and felt like it came out of the blue, but the story itself felt pretty long. The side characters were also pretty stereotypical and were almost forced into the story to be stock characters. But perhaps my most flawed character was the male MC himself who seemed to have reverse character development, where he got really annoying and unsupportive by the end. It's still a decent Christmas read if you're looking for something light during the holidays.
